How the Best Car Deals Actually Work — A Simple, Factual Breakdown

First, timing: rental pricing fluctuates based on season, event demand, and availability. Peak months—spring and fall—see higher competition, so booking 30–60 days ahead often yields better rates. Last-minute rentals may carry surcharges or limited fleet options, especially near festivals or peak tourist periods tied to places like the Tucson Rodeo or Palm Springs Art Museum.
